Abstract

We are reporting a case of cutaneous sarcoidosis with asymptomatic systemic involvement evident by investigation. Management of cutaneous sarcoidosis is challenging. However, maculopapular rash, which usually show better prognosis respond promptly by high dose of systemic steroid with gradual tapering dose.Bangladesh Crit Care J September 2014; 2 (2): 87-89
